
Maternal Health & Safe Birth
Maternal health within Shuar de la Selva is guided by Shuar women and midwives, whose knowledge of pregnancy, birth, and postpartum care has been passed down through generations. Our role is to support and strengthen this existing wisdom, while improving safety, access to information, and practical resources for mothers and families.
Working together with Shuar midwives, the initiative focuses on safe birth practices, maternal education, and community-based support before, during, and after pregnancy. This includes sharing information that helps women recognize risk signs, prepare for birth, and access appropriate care when needed—while respecting cultural practices and decision-making at every step.

The goal is not to introduce external models of birth, but to ensure that women have support, dignity, and safety, whether birth takes place at home, in the community, or with additional medical assistance when required. Education empowers women and families to make informed choices that align with their values and realities.
By strengthening maternal health at the community level, Shuar de la Selva supports healthier mothers, healthier babies, and stronger families—laying an essential foundation for the wellbeing of future generations.
